  • Abstract
    This paper addresses the problem of robust state and output feedback tracking controller design for uncertain nonlinear systems with time delays, in which the lumped uncertainties are not in the span of the control input space. The proposed control strategy can guarantee that the closed-loop system is uniformly and ultimately bounded. The present methodology is illustrated through an example of a chemical reactor system
